When connecting a beam with a crosshole to a beam with a round hole use this peg for a spinning connection.



You can also put a cross-axle through a round hole so it spins freely. This is a useful connection for building with wheels and gears.

SMOOTH AND FRICTION PEGS

There are 2 kinds of pegs. Some are smooth and allow parts to spin freely. Others use friction to limit spinning. In newer TECHNIC sets, these pegs are color-coded to help you spot the difference easily.

Friction:

Smooth:

You can use smooth and friction pegs to control how fast and freely your TECHNIC parts rotate!
